YEP Directors’ Festival: Eggs

Eggs is an upbeat comedy following the lives of two scouse women struggling to cope with the ups and downs of life.

Written by Florence Keith Roach and directed by Mary Savage, this female led production focuses on friendship, fertility and freaking out.

Although friends through university, the women are living two very different lives now. The only things that brings them together are their life struggles, their freak outs and a mutual love for 90’s music.

Eggs shows the two women coming to terms with the littlest and largest horrors in life, from getting nits as an adult to grieving over a lost friend. Tackling relevant society struggles, no topic is taboo for the mismatched friendship. Using dark humour to deal with the complexities of sex, drugs, careers, relationships and everyday problems.

First performed at the Vault Festival in 2016, this superbly funny performance is being brought to Liverpool for one night only to be given a scouse twist. Expect lots of laughs and a few cracks along the way.

Part of the YEP Directors’ Festival 2021
